Anna Czarnik-Neimeyer is the assistant director and chief of staff at St. Norbert College’s Cassandra Voss Center (CVC). A sister center to the bell hooks Institute in Berea, Ky., the CVC focuses on transformation through initiatives related to race, class, gender and identity.
